Lab Instance: XXXXXXXX. Task 2 You discover that all users can apply the Confidential – Finance label. You need to ensure that the Confidential – Finance label is available only to the members of the Leadership group. Answer:
Assign sensitivity labels to Microsoft 365 groups in Microsoft Entra ID Microsoft Entra ID supports applying sensitivity labels published by the Microsoft Purview compliance portal to Microsoft 365 groups. Sensitivity labels apply to groups across services like Outlook, Microsoft Teams, and SharePoint. Assign a label to an existing group in the Microsoft Entra admin center Step 1: Sign in to the Microsoft Entra admin center as at least a Global Administrator. Step 2: Select Microsoft Entra ID. Step 3: Select Groups Step 4: From the All groups page, select the group that you want to label. Step 5: On the selected group's page, select Properties and select a sensitivity label from the list. Select the Confidential - Finance label Step 6: Select Save to save your changes. Reference:
